How they compare
Sweden currently reports 98.1 against 98 in Finland, a difference of 0.1.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 23 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Sweden ahead.
Finland ranks 9th and Sweden ranks 7th of 46 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Finland averaged higher in 1 and Sweden in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Finland | Sweden |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 74.08 | 81.74 | 7.66 | Sweden |
| 2010s | 91.8 | 93.39 | 1.59 | Sweden |
| 2020s | 97.34 | 97.28 | 0.06 | Finland |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
